Do magnets lose their magnetism? - Physics Stack Exchange

Web22 de out. de 2024 · If you heat a permanent magnet up past its Currie temperature, the magnetic dipoles get enough energy to stop being aligned and the material will lose its magnetization. The Earth's magnetic field comes from moving electically conducting fluid in its core, via the so called "dynamo effect", see here.
